Minnesota Housing is hiring! We're a mission-focused financial institution looking for a Legal Operations Manager to improve the efficiency and effectiveness of legal operations at the Agency. This candidate will handle the logistical, financial and administrative aspects of the Legal team. Such duties include managing legal technology, working with vendors, overseeing budgets, and drafting and improving internal processes. The candidate will also work with the General Counsel to process and make recommendations on conflicts of interest. The Legal Operations Manager will, in conjunction with other Legal team members, work on Agency documents to ensure consistency in process and procedure for internal and external stakeholders. The candidate will provide administrative support for Legal team related to contracting, rulemaking, and data practices to ensure legal compliance at the Minnesota Housing.
Essential Job Duties
Manages legal technology and working with vendors.
Provides executive, technical, and administrative expertise related to contracting, rulemaking, and data practices to ensure legal compliance.
Ensures that the processes, procedures, and Agency documents are consistent and usable for internal and external stakeholders. Identifies processes and procedures that require updates and work with appropriate legal and program staff.
Prioritize multiple projects and legal resources to manage process and meet applicable deadlines.
Review and assist in conflict of interest (COI) evaluations in conjunction with the General Counsel.
Perform other duties as assigned to optimize efficiency of and ensure smooth functioning of the Legal team and maintain the reputation of Minnesota Housing as a valuable business partner.
